Driving Smart Devices with Battery-Friendly Edge AI
The proliferation of smart devices necessitates innovative solutions to extend battery life. Edge AI offers a compelling strategy by processing data locally, minimizing the need for constant communication with the cloud and consequently conserving precious power. By deploying lightweight AI models directly on devices, we can enable a new generation of always-on, self-sufficient smart devices that are truly sustainable.

Building Intelligent Systems with Edge AI
The realm of artificial intelligence (AI) is rapidly growing, and with it comes the emergence of edge AI as a powerful paradigm. Edge AI empowers intelligent systems to process data locally on devices at the network's edge, rather than relying solely on centralized cloud computing. This distributed approach offers numerous benefits, including reduced latency, enhanced privacy, and improved dependability. By bringing AI capabilities closer to the data, edge AI enables real-time decision-making and fosters a new generation of groundbreaking applications across diverse industries.
- Example, in smart cities, edge AI can be deployed on traffic sensors to optimize vehicle movement, while in healthcare, it can aid doctors in recognizing diseases from patient records.
- Furthermore, the ability of edge AI to function offline or with limited connectivity opens up possibilities in remote or resource-constrained environments.
